I bought the truck and the trans was fine, I replaced a bad electronic transmission sensor for the speedometer , changed the fluid and filter and now it's not shifting right, it's winds up to about 3000 Rpms and then when I come to a stop it won't down shift and the truck dies, the shifting is inconsistent and is just getting worse and worse. I put in oreillys generic ATF that they said was fine but on the bottle it says reccomened for Chevy and ford. Please help. It's got about 135000 miles

You can't just "change it now. You will only get about 1/3 of the fluid out of it as most of the fluid is in the torque convert and cooling line/radiator. You can try changing just what's in the pan and filter but I would HIGHLY suggest getting it flushed.

I think it's been said NEVER use anything but ATF+4 in these trucks. If flushing the transmission solves it, I'd be filing a claim with O'riellys corporate. Hopefully you havn't ruined your tranny. You'll need to get about all of that generic dexron out of there!

Lesson to the wise...never take Dodge advice from a person in a discount auto store who's never owned one.
